Study Overview

Attracting top talent is a challenge facing all companies. This benchmarking exchange was designed to uncover the number of MBA’s accepting positions at companies listed in Fortune’s Top 50 Most Desirable MBA Employer List. Companies can use this 18-page document to compare their hiring methods and success with other companies.

Key Topics

  • Full-time offers and acceptance rates
  • Percentage of minority, female and international hires
  • Salary packages
  • Recruiting costs

Key Findings
  • In line with economic trends, half the benchmark class plan to increase their MBA hiring rates in 2005.
  • The benchmark class average acceptance rate excluding intern conversions is 72%.
  • Only 14% of the companies in the benchmark class listed compensation as a reason for declines.

Methodology
Partners include human resources executives from 14 leading, companies across five industries. This presentation is the result of primary research conducted on behalf of the Business Excellence Board.
